Angry Kenyans' comments crash Senate email address

Kenya’s Senate email system crashed following massive public response to a bill proposing a seven-year term for the president, governors, and MPs, along with other constitutional amendments.

Submitted by Senator Samson Cherargei, the bill has sparked widespread anger, with over 200,000 emails flooding the Senate’s system.

Although Cherargei argues longer terms would help leaders deliver on promises, President Ruto’s United Democratic Alliance (UDA) has condemned the bill.

Public scrutiny of lawmakers is high, as many struggle with inflation, and recent tax protests turned violent.

A Senate committee will review public feedback on the controversial proposal.
